Material Notes:
Versaflex™ CL2000X is an ultra-soft TPE designed for use in injection molding applications where exceptional clarity and an extremely soft feel are desired. - Tactile Feel - Ultra-Soft - Water ClarityColor concentrates with Versaflex™ CL2000X as the carrier are most suitable for coloring this product. If a CL2000X color concentrate carrier is desired, it is important that the chosen color house have underwater pelletization capabilities. Typical loadings for color concentrates are 1% to 5% by weight. Liquid color (pigment, not dye) can be used; white oil carriers are recommended. A high color match consistency can be obtained by using precolored compounds available from GLS. Polypropylene (PP) based color concentrates are not recommended because they lead to poor dispersion and can significantly change the hardness of the material. Concentrates based on PVC should not be used. The final determination of color concentrate suitability should be determined by customer trials. Purge thoroughly before and after use of this product with a low flow (0.5 - 2.5 MFR) polyethylene (PE) or polypropylene (PP). Regrind levels up to 20% can be used with Versaflex™ CL2000X with minimal property loss, provided that the regrind is free of contamination. To minimize losses during molding, the melt temperature should remian as low as possible. The final determination of regrind effectiveness should be determined by the customer. Drying is not Required Injection Speed: 0.5 to 2 in/sec 1st Stage - Boost Pressure: 100 to 400 psi 2nd Stage - Hold Pressure: 30% of Boost Hold Time (Thick Part): 2 to 10 sec Hold Time (Thin Part): 1 to 3 secInformation provided by PolyOne
